Attendees: R. Calloway, D. Venn, S. Okoro.

The licensing dispute with Ferndale Instruments over the Quillstone toolkit remains unresolved. Counsel advises our usage falls within the original 2021 agreement, but Ferndale asserts the Meadowrick expansion constitutes a new deployment. Mediation is scheduled for next month in Carlowe. Venn will prepare a cost comparison of settlement versus continued negotiation. No public statements until mediation concludes. The following note is appended for the incoming director's eyes only.

board note of tadup-tajog: Headcount on the Oliiel team goes from 31 to 88 by the end of February. Gross margin on Oliiel came in at 62 percent against a plan of 29 percent.

☐ Key ceremony, step 4: decommission the old Gritline job queue signing key. Confirm the replacement broker (Spindleworks) is live and draining jobs. Two Harrowgate ops staff must witness. Shred the old key material, log the time, initial the sheet. To unlock the transfer vault, enter the recovery passphrase shown here:

recovery phrase for fajeg-hagug: holox-fenmir

## Environments — StillPress incremental rebuilds

StillPress rebuilds only pages whose content hash changed. Three environments: sandbox (full rebuilds, no cache), staging (incremental, shared cache), prod (incremental, per-region cache). Never point staging at the prod cache bucket; hash collisions there caused the Fernlow outage. Rebuild queue drains every two minutes. The staging environment currently runs with the following configuration.

config for kawif-hahig:
zorix:
  log_level: error
  metrics_host: metrics.zorix.lumiclabs.internal
  pool_size: 16

Subject: Partner SFTP drop — new owner

Hi,

As you review the pending changes to the Harborline ingest scripts, note that ownership of the partner SFTP drop is changing at the end of the month. This includes key rotation, the nightly pull job, and the quarantine folder for malformed files. Review comments on the retry logic should still go through the normal PR flow, but questions about drop-folder conventions or partner onboarding now go to the new owner. The incoming owner is listed below.

signatory, tagaf-bahaf: Praael Fenmir Rusok